The OpportunityAs our firm continues to grow, we’re looking for an ambitious and proactive Audit Manager to join our team and help develop our audit services. You’ll play a central role in managing and expanding our audit offering, supporting our clients, and helping build a strong audit team.
Key Responsibilities:Lead and manage audit engagements from planning to completion
Develop audit strategies, time frames, and ensure deadlines are met
Build relationships with clients and identify new business opportunities
Contribute to the growth of the audit client base
Supervise, support, and mentor junior team members
Stay current with UK GAAP, auditing standards, and key tax implications (PAYE, Corporation Tax, VAT)
About YouWe’re looking for someone who is:
ACA/ACCA qualified, with at least 3-5 years post-qualification audit experience
Commercially aware with strong problem-solving skills
Experienced in managing audits and leading teams
Confident with PCAS Audit Programmes (ideal, but not essential)
Professional, personable, and a natural relationship builder
Driven with a positive, “can-do” attitude
Eager to grow professionally in a supportive and dynamic environment
